Wiscasset, ME
Assets: $669k
Revenue: $131k
Employees: 3
MISSION:
TO COLLECT, PRESERVE, AND INTERPRET THE HISTORY OF LINCOLN COUNTY, MAINE, WHICH ONCE EXTENDED FROM BRUNSWICK TO CANADA. WE ARE STEWARDS OF THREE HISTORICAL BUILDINGS: THE 1761 POWNALBOROUGH COURT HOUSE IN DRESDEN, THE 1811 OLD JAIL IN WISCASSET, AND THE 1754 CHAPMAN-HALL HOUSE IN DAMARISCOTTA.
